Welcome to the Verdanta plugin program. Our GrowMesh greenhouse controller recalibrates humidity and CO2 sensors every six hours, because drift in the Thornquist probe series can exceed 3% per day in high-moisture zones. Your plugin must never cache raw sensor values longer than one calibration cycle; always query the corrected feed. If your plugin needs to unlock the calibration vault during testing, use the passphrase below.

unlock words, yawig-kagef: gordor-holvan-ulaael-pramir-ulaiel-tamdor

## Releases

Heads up, plugin folks: starting with 3.4, the Quillseek autocomplete index is rebuilt lazily, so first-run completions can feel sluggish for a minute or two — that's expected, not a bug in your plugin. Ship your plugin builds against the 3.4 SDK and re-run the compat suite before tagging. Every release tarball must be verifiable against our publishing key, which we reproduce here for your tooling.

release key, hagug-yaguf: bky13_NnhXrmFGhCRtW

- [ ] **Step 7: Breaker override escrow.** After sealing the signing keys for the Tallgrove upstream API circuit breaker, confirm the support team can force the breaker open during a full outage. The override bundle lives in the sealed escrow drawer and is useless without its unlock phrase. Two ceremony witnesses must initial this step before proceeding. The escrow bundle is decrypted with the recovery passphrase that follows.

vault phrase of kahip-kahop = holath-quenmir